Devilmaycry_11's Badges » Hard » Most AwardedAll Badges
Sort:
Badge earned
Mega-Maximum Hyper Throwdown ...
(completed)
Devilmaycry_11 earned this badge in Animation Throwdown on Aug. 29, 2024.
|